The Université de Sherbrooke Dermatology Residency Program is a comprehensive 5-year training program that provides residents with extensive clinical experience across multiple dermatological subspecialties. The first two years are completed at Université de Sherbrooke, with the remaining three years transferred to McGill University, offering a unique and collaborative training experience.

Program Overview

Teaching Philosophy

The program emphasizes competency-based medical education with regular formative assessments, focusing on developing clinical skills, scholarly activities, and professional competencies through continuous feedback and evaluation.

Training Setting

Training primarily occurs at CHUS (Hôpital Fleurimont and Hôtel-Dieu in Sherbrooke), with additional rotations at affiliated hospitals including Hôpital Charles-Le Moyne, CSSS de Chicoutimi, and Hôpital Ste-Justine.

Curriculum & Rotations

PGY-1 Rotations

Internal Medicine1 block
Pediatrics1 block
Emergency1 block
Infectious Diseases1 block
Rheumatology1 block
ORL1 block
Immuno-Allergology1 block
Nephrology Kidney Transplant1 block
Dermato-Pathology1 block
Dermatology Sherbrooke3 blocks
Dermatology Chicoutimi1 block

PGY-2 Rotations

Dermatology Sherbrooke11 blocks
Pediatric Dermato-Pediatrics Hôpital Ste-Justine Montreal1 block
Dermatology Chicoutimi or Charles-Lemoyne1 block
Mohs Surgery and Pediatric DermatologyLongitudinal exposure
Optional Stage1 block
